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
44 MEADOW ROAD Detached £378,745 £330,000 7 Dec 2020
46 MEADOW ROAD Detached £338,577 £280,000 31 Jul 2020
54 MEADOW ROAD Detached £345,003 £319,000 19 Nov 2021
58 MEADOW ROAD Detached £177,463 £143,500 5 Apr 2019
62 MEADOW ROAD Detached £554,689 £321,000 1 Jul 2011